Jagex = Mystery
Jagex is a medium sized company based in Cambridge England with around 300-400 employees. As from a few days ago the CEO (boss) of Jagex is Geoff Iddison, who used to be the European CEO of PayPal. He takes over from Constant Tedder. The company is a development from a hobby, and not as a full business... so as such it has a very good working environment where the vast majority of staff are extreamly happy, they where voted in the top 100 companies to work for a while back. Not only do Jagex care about their staff, they also care about their community trying to keep it strong and offer constant updates that they hope will please the players. jagex is very much no motivated by money, although obviously as a business money is VERY important.
